On a serious note, my Sissy tried to eat a fairly large toad last year. Thankfully as it secreted its yucky stuff into her mouth she spit it out. She began foaming at the mouth and spitting like crazy. About two hours later she started vomitting - every hour throughout the night. Needless to say, we were at the vet when they opened in the morning for sub-Q fluids and anti-nausea meds. I did call the ER vet as soon as she started foaming/spitting, but the tech I talked to was so rude that there is no way I would pay $80 just to walk in the door and then be treated like crap. So, I slept with her in my arms, comforted her each time she threw up and then gave her pedialyte by syringe.
We don't have poisonous frogs or toads in Michigan, but at least the toads will secret toxins to make their aggressers ill!!
